Everything Electrical Installation Encompasses
Electrical installation is a broad category that includes almost every component of bringing power systems into a structure or updating what's existing. This includes everything from panel upgrades and extending circuits throughout a home to adding receptacles and connecting lighting systems. The scope of electrical installation work covers residential homes, commercial properties, and multi-unit developments.
Understanding who needs electrical installation services matters. New property owners typically require comprehensive wiring from scratch, while current homeowners may pursue targeted upgrades like expanding their panel capacity. Business owners might require dedicated circuit work to run technology-intensive operations. Whatever your project type, professional electrical installation ensures the work is finished to code the very first time.
It's just as important to understand that electrical installation falls under strict guidelines by the National Electrical Code plus local building regulations. Projects finished outside of these guidelines often eliminates homeowner's insurance, complicate future home sales, and place occupants in unsafe conditions. A licensed electrician handles permits as part of every project.

How long does a typical electrical installation project take?
Project timelines are shaped by the size of the electrical installation. Simple projects like fixture replacements are typically finished in half a day. Complex installations like whole-home rewiring typically span two to five days depending on structural factors.
Panel Upgrade vs. Service Upgrade — What's the Distinction?
Upgrading your panel typically refers to swapping out the breaker panel with a newer unit while maintaining the existing power supply from the utility. A service upgrade requires boosting the power supply from the street, often from 100 to 200 amps. Certain installations involve both components.
Do I need a permit for electrical installation work?
With very few exceptions, yes — most wiring work that includes new circuits must be permitted. Permits aren't just paperwork — the inspection process verifies that the work meets safety standards. Our team handles all permitting for you.
What are the signs that I need new electrical installation?
Several warning signs point to that your home probably requires updated electrical installation. Watch for circuit breakers that trip regularly, inconsistent lighting throughout the home, warm or discolored outlet covers, a lack of grounded receptacles, and a small breaker box that can't handle modern loads.
